SpaceX Ending Production of Flagship Crew Capsule (reuters.com) 38

SpaceX has ended production of new Crew Dragon astronaut capsules, a company executive told Reuters, as Elon Musk's space transportation company heaps resources on its next-generation spaceship program. From the report: Capping the fleet at four Crew Dragons adds more urgency to the development of the astronaut capsule's eventual successor, Starship, SpaceX's moon and Mars rocket. Starship's debut launch has been delayed for months by engine development hurdles and regulatory reviews. It also poses new challenges as the company learns how to maintain a fleet and quickly fix unexpected problems without holding up a busy schedule of astronaut missions.

"We are finishing our final (capsule), but we still are manufacturing components, because we'll be refurbishing," SpaceX President Gwynne Shotwell told Reuters, confirming the plan to end Crew Dragon manufacturing. She added that SpaceX would retain the capability to build more capsules if a need arises in the future, but contended that "fleet management is key." Musk's business model is underpinned by reusable spacecraft, so it was inevitable the company would cease production at some point. But the timing was not known, nor was his strategy of using the existing fleet for its full backlog of missions.
"Crew Dragon has flown five crews of government and private astronauts to space since 2020, when it flew its first pair of NASA astronauts and became the U.S. space agency's primary ride for getting humans to and from the International Space Station," notes Reuters.

NASA Wants Another Moon Lander For Artemis Astronauts, Not Just SpaceX's Starship (space.com) 113

NASA plans to encourage the development of another commercial vehicle that can land its Artemis astronauts on the moon. Space.com reports: In April 2021, NASA picked SpaceX to build the first crewed lunar lander for the agency's Artemis program, which is working to put astronauts on the moon in the mid-2020s and establish a sustainable human presence on and around Earth's nearest neighbor by the end of the decade. But SpaceX apparently won't have the moon-landing market cornered: NASA announced today (March 23) that it plans to support the development of a second privately built crewed lunar lander.

"This strategy expedites progress toward a long-term, sustaining lander capability as early as the 2026 or 2027 timeframe," Lisa Watson-Morgan, program manager for the Human Landing System Program at NASA's Marshall Space Flight Center in Alabama, said in a statement today. "We expect to have two companies safely carry astronauts in their landers to the surface of the moon under NASA's guidance before we ask for services, which could result in multiple experienced providers in the market," Watson-Morgan added. [...] Congress is "committed to ensuring that we have more than one lander to choose [from] for future missions," [NASA Administrator Bill Nelson] said during a news conference today, citing conversations he's had with people on Capitol Hill over the past year. "We're expecting to have both Congress support and that of the Biden administration," Nelson said. "And we're expecting to get this competition started in the fiscal year [20]23 budget."

Exact funding amounts and other details should be coming next week when the White House releases its 2023 federal budget request, he added. "So what we're doing today is a bit of a preview," Nelson said. "I think you'll find it's an indication that there are good things to come for this agency and, if we're right, good things to come for all of humanity." NASA plans to release a draft request for proposals (RFP) for the second moon lander by the end of the month and a final RFP later this spring, agency officials said. If all goes according to plan, NASA will pick the builder of the new vehicle in early 2023. That craft will have the ability to dock with Gateway, the small moon-orbiting space station that NASA plans to build, and take people and scientific gear from there to the surface (and back). This newly announced competition will be open to all American companies except SpaceX. But Elon Musk's company will have the opportunity to negotiate the terms of its existing contract to perform additional lunar development work, NASA officials said during today's news conference.

NASA Confirms 5,000 Exoplanets (cnet.com) 58

NASA JPL announced a cosmic milestone with the confirmed discovery of over 5,000 exoplanets (planets located outside our solar system). CNET reports: A new batch of 65 planets joined the NASA Exoplanet Archive on Monday, triggering a celebratory mood. "It's not just a number," Exoplanet Archive science lead Jessie Christiansen said in a statement. "Each one of them is a new world, a brand new planet. I get excited about every one because we don't know anything about them."

The first exoplanets were confirmed in the early 1990s, which means we've set an impressive pace for discovery. NASA announced the planet count had hit 4,000 in June 2019 and it took less than three years to add another thousand to that haul. [...] We haven't definitively found an Earth clone yet, but the exoplanets spotted so far range from rocky worlds like ours to jumbo gas giants bigger than Jupiter. While 5,000 is an impressive number, it's just a tiny sliver of what's out there. Said NASA, "We do know this: Our galaxy likely holds hundreds of billions of such planets."

Chinese Airliner Crashes With 132 Aboard in Country's South (engadget.com) 123

A China Eastern Boeing 737-800 with 132 people on board crashed in a remote mountainous area of southern China on Monday, officials said, setting off a forest fire visible from space in the country's worst air disaster in nearly a decade. From a report: More than seven hours after communication was lost with the plane, there was still no word of survivors. The Civil Aviation Administration of China said in a statement the crash occurred near the city of Wuzhou in the Guangxi region. The flight was traveling from Kunming in the southwestern province of Yunnan to the industrial center of Guangzhou along the east coast, it added. Villagers were first to arrive at the forested area where the plane went down, sparking a blaze big enough to be seen on NASA satellite images. Hundreds of rescue workers were swiftly dispatched from Guangxi and neighboring Guangdong province. State media reported all 737-800s in China Eastern's fleet were ordered grounded, while broadcaster CCTV said the airliner had set up nine teams to deal with aircraft disposal, accident investigation, family assistance and other pressing matters.

NASA's Megarocket, the Space Launch System, Rolls Out To Its Launchpad 83

On Thursday, NASA's new giant rocket, the Space Launch System, emerged out into the Florida air, embarking on a torturously slow 11-hour journey to its primary launchpad at Kennedy Space Center. The Verge reports: It was a big moment for NASA, having spent more than a decade on the development of this rocket, with the goal of using the vehicle to send cargo and people into deep space. The rollout of the SLS was just a taste of what's to come. The rocket will undergo what is known as a wet dress rehearsal in April, going through all the operations and procedures it will go through during a typical launch, including filling up its tanks with propellant. If that goes well, then the rocket will be rolled back to NASA's Vehicle Assembly Building, the giant cavernous building where the SLS was pieced together. Following a few more tests, the rocket will be rolled back out to the launchpad ahead of its first flight, scheduled for sometime this summer at the earliest. Ancient Magnetic Fields On the Moon Could Be Protecting Precious Ice (science.org) 32

sciencehabit shares a report from Science.org: For years, scientists have believed frigid craters at the Moon's poles hold water ice, which would be both a scientific boon and a potential resource for human missions. Now, researchers have discovered (PDF) a reason why the ice has persisted on an otherwise bone-dry world: Some polar craters may be protected by ancient magnetic fields. Researchers have known about the anomalies ever since the Apollo 15 and 16 missions in 1971 and 1972, when astronauts measured regions of unusual magnetic strength on the surface. Some anomalies are now known to be up to hundreds of kilometers across. Although their origin is debated, one possibility is they were created more than 4 billion years ago when the Moon had a magnetic field and iron-rich asteroids crashed into its surface. The resultant molten material may have been permanently magnetized.

Thousands of the anomalies are thought to exist across the lunar surface, but the team mapped ones at the south pole in detail using data from Japan's Kaguya spacecraft, which orbited the Moon from 2007 to 2009. They found at least two permanently shadowed craters that were overlapped by these anomalies, the Sverdrup and Shoemaker craters, and there are likely more. Although the remnant fields are thousands of times weaker than Earth's, they could be sufficient to deflect the solar wind. Craters with known anomalies could become prime targets for science and exploration. NASA is already planning to visit the south polar region with a rover due for launch next year, called VIPER, and the agency intends to send humans there later this decade as part of its Artemis program. Studying the ice could reveal how it was delivered, which may in turn shed light on how Earth got its water.

NASA's Webb Space Telescope Achieves Near-Perfect Focus (cbsnews.com) 46

BeerFartMoron shares a report from CBS News: After weeks of microscopic adjustments, NASA unveiled the first fully focused image from the James Webb Space Telescope Wednesday, a razor-sharp engineering photo of a nondescript star in a field of more distant galaxies that shows the observatory's optical system is working in near-flawless fashion. The goal was to demonstrate Webb can now bring starlight to a near-perfect focus, proving the $10 billion telescope doesn't suffer from any subtle optical defects like the aberration that initially hobbled the Hubble Space Telescope. The galaxies in the image were a bonus, whetting astronomers' appetites for discoveries to come. "This is one of the most magnificent days in my whole career at NASA, frankly, and for many of us astronomers, one of the most important days that we've had," said NASA science chief Thomas Zurbuchen. "Today we can announce that the optics will perform to specifications or even better. It's an amazing achievement."

Ex-NASA Astronaut Scott Kelly Says He's Ending Feud With Russian Space Chief (wsj.com) 37

Former astronaut Scott Kelly said he is ending his feud with the head of Russia's space program after the National Aeronautics and Space Administration asked former astronauts to dial down criticism of their Russian counterparts. From a report: The dustup began when Roscosmos Director General Dmitry Rogozin and other Russian government entities published a series of social-media posts, including one video showing Russian cosmonauts abandoning the International Space Station and leaving behind U.S. astronaut Mark Vande Hei. Mr. Kelly, who spent nearly a year in 2015 and 2016 aboard the ISS, got into a heated exchange on Twitter last week with the Russian space chief over the series of posts. Now Mr. Kelly said he is ending the spat with Mr. Rogozin after NASA sent an email to former astronauts asking them to stop criticizing their Russian partners because it was hurting the mission aboard the ISS, an orbiting lab where American astronauts and Russian cosmonauts work side by side. "I respect their position. They have a tough job. I believe in NASA and what they do. I want to help them. I respect the person that sent it greatly," Mr. Kelly said in an interview. "I would say that if I was in their position, I would have done the same exact thing."

US Astronaut's Return Hangs in the Balance as Tensions With Russia Escalate (theguardian.com) 70

The US astronaut Mark Vande Hei has made it through nearly a year in space, but now faces what could be his trickiest assignment: riding a Russian capsule back to Earth in the midst of deepening tension between the two countries. From a report: Nasa insists Vande Hei's homecoming at the end of the month remains unchanged, even as Russia's invasion of Ukraine has resulted in canceled launches, broken contracts and an escalating war of words from the leader of the Russian Space Agency. Many worry Dmitry Rogozin is putting decades of peaceful partnership at risk, most notably at the International Space Station (ISS). Vande Hei, who on Tuesday will break the US single spaceflight record of 340 days, is due to leave with two Russians aboard a Soyuz capsule for touchdown in Kazakhstan on 30 March. He will have logged 355 days in space. The world record of 438 days belongs to Russia.

The retired Nasa astronaut Scott Kelly, America's record-holder until Tuesday, is among those sparring with Rogozin, a longtime ally of Vladimir Putin. Kelly has returned a medal to the Russian embassy in Washington but believes the two sides "can hold it together" in space. "We need an example set that two countries that historically have not been on the most friendly of terms, can still work somewhere peacefully. And that somewhere is the International Space Station. That's why we need to fight to keep it," Kelly said. Nasa wants to keep the space station running until 2030, as do the European, Japanese and Canadian space agencies. The Russians have not committed beyond the original end date of 2024 or so.

And USA Today published an article which shares the history of how Pi Day got started. Former physicist Larry Shaw, who connected March 14 with 3.14, celebrated the first Pi Day at the Exploratorium with fruit pies and tea in 1988. The museum said Shaw led Pi Day parades there every year until his passing in 2017.

In 2009, the U.S. House of Representatives passed a resolution marking March 14 as National Pi Day.

The date is significant in the world of science. Albert Einstein was born on this day in 1879. The Exploratorium said it added a celebration of Einstein's life as part of its Pi Day activities after Shaw's daughter, Sara, realized the coincidence. March 14 also marks the death of renowned theoretical physicist Stephen Hawking, who passed away in 2018.

Computer History Museum Publishes Memories of the Programmer for NASA's Moon Missions (computerhistory.org) 45

This week Silicon Valley's Computer History Museum posted a PDF transcript (and video excerpts) from an interview with 81-year-old Margaret Hamilton, the programmer/systems designer who in the 1960s became director of the Software Engineering Division at the MIT Instrumentation Laboratory which developed the on-board flight software for NASA's Apollo program. Prior to that Hamilton had worked on software to detect an airplane's radar signature, but thought, "You know, 'I guess I should delay graduate school again because I'd like to work on this program that puts all these men on the Moon....'"

"There was always one thing that stood out in my mind, being in the onboard flight software, was that it was 'man rated,' meaning if it didn't work a person's life was at stake if not over. That was always uppermost in my mind and probably many others as well."

Interestingly, Hamilton had originally received two job offers from the Apollo Space Program, and had told them to flip a coin to settle it. ("The other job had to do with support systems. It was software, but it wasn't the onboard flight software.") But what's fascinating is the interview's glimpses at some of the earliest days of the programming profession: There was all these engineers, okay? Hardware engineers, aeronautical engineers and all this, a lot of them out of MIT... But the whole idea of software and programming...? Dick Battin, Dr. Battin, when they told him that they were going to be responsible for the software...he went home to his wife and said he was going to be in charge of software and he thought it was some soft clothing...
Hamilton also remembers in college taking a summer job as a student actuary at Travelers Insurance in the mid-1950s, and "all of a sudden one day word was going around Travelers that there were these new things out there called computers that were going to take away all of their jobs... Pretty soon they wouldn't have jobs. And so everybody was talking about it. They were scared they wouldn't have a way to make a living.

"But, of course, it ended up being more jobs were created with the computers than there were...."

Watch an Asteroid Flying By Earth (newsweek.com) 18

Right now an asteroid is zooming past earth "at a relatively close distance" reports Newsweek, "and the event can be viewed live." The asteroid, called 2022 ES3, will be traveling at 41,000 miles per hour when it comes between the moon and the Earth at around 2:18 p.m. ET on Sunday, March 13, according to NASA's Center for Near Earth Object Studies (CNEOS).

The space rock isn't expected to hit Earth. Instead, it will pass by at a distance of about 206,000 miles, which is about 87 percent of the distance between us and the moon.

The event provides a great viewing opportunity. An Italian astronomy organization called the Virtual Telescope Project, which often tracks asteroids and other space objects through the sky, is due to host a livestream of what it calls 2022 ES3's "very close, but safe, encounter with us" on its WebTV page starting at 18:30 UTC on March 13th.

Astronomers don't consider 2022 ES3 to be potentially hazardous, probably due to its size. The asteroid is predicted to be somewhere between 33 and 72 feet in diameter — about as wide as the length of a bowling lane.... [S]cientists track more than 28,000 near-Earth asteroids as they travel through the solar system. Around 900 of these are more than one kilometer, or 3,280 feet, in size.

No, Russia Has Not Threatened To Leave An American Astronaut Behind In Space (arstechnica.com) 73

Ever since Russia invaded Ukraine, the fate of the International Space Station, which has 15 partner nations and is the crown jewel of unity in space between NASA and Russia, has been up in the air (figuratively, of course). What we do know is that there are no plans to abandon NASA astronaut Mark Vande Hei on the space station, despite a number of stories claiming otherwise. "Vande Hei is scheduled to return to Earth in a Soyuz capsule at the end of this month, landing in Kazakhstan," reports Ars Technica. "NASA officials are expected to be there to greet him and bring him back to the United States." Ars Technica sets the record straight and explains where these Russian "threats" originated: The source of this "news" appears to be a video published more than a week ago by a Kremlin-aligned publication, RIA Novosti. Roscosmos TV provided footage for the video, but in sharing it acknowledged that the video was a "joke." Now, this is an exceptionally poor joke given the tensions on Earth, but it is important to understand that sharing a video a week ago does not mean Russia is threatening to leave Vande Hei behind. Nothing has changed since the video was posted. Since the beginning of this crisis, NASA officials have said operations with Russian colleagues working on the space station have proceeded nominally. "Operations have not changed at all," one NASA source confirmed Friday. On Monday, NASA's manager of the International Space Program, Joel Montalbano, is scheduled to speak at a news conference about upcoming spacewalks. He likely will say something similar.

Additionally, Vande Hei could not be abandoned. At present there are three other Americans living on board the International Space Station -- Raja Chari, Kayla Barron, and Thomas Marshburn. There is also an allied astronaut, Matthias Maurer, from Germany. NASA has its own transportation to and from the station, so Vande Hei can be assured of a safe ride home whenever NASA wants. The status of the ISS partnership is subject to change, of course. It could do so quite quickly. Russia is doing horrible things in Ukraine, and the Western world has responded with harsh sanctions. No one really knows whether Vladimir Putin will decide to end Russian participation in the International Space Station. Certainly, making it appear to a domestic audience that he was stranding a NASA astronaut in space might make him look "strong" to some Russian people. But there are simply no indications this will happen.

NASA Is Opening a Vacuum-Sealed Sample It Took From the Moon 50 Years Ago (npr.org) 28

Scientists at NASA's Johnson Space Center in Houston are preparing to open the first tube that one of the astronauts on the Apollo missions hammered into the surface of the moon. As NPR reports, it's "remained tightly sealed all these years since that 1972 Apollo 17 mission -- the last time humans set foot on the moon." From the report: The unsealed tube from that mission was opened in 2019. The layers of lunar soil had been preserved, and the sample offered insight into subjects like landslides in airless places. Because the sample being opened now has been sealed, it may contain something in addition to rocks and soil: gas. The tube could contain substances known as volatiles, which evaporate at normal temperatures, such as water ice and carbon dioxide. The materials at the bottom of the tube were extremely cold at the time they were collected. The amount of these gases in the sample is expected to be very low, so scientists are using a special device called a manifold, designed by a team at Washington University in St. Louis, to extract and collect the gas.

Another tool was developed at the European Space Agency (ESA) to pierce the sample and capture the gases as they escape. Scientists there have called that tool the "Apollo can opener." The careful process of opening and capturing has begun, and so far, so good: the seal on the inner sample tube seems to be intact. Now, the piercing process is underway, with that special "can opener" ready to trap whatever gases might come out. If there are gases in the sample, scientists will be able to use modern mass spectrometry technology to identify them. (Mass spectrometry is a tool for analyzing and measuring molecules.) The gas could also be divided into tiny samples for other researchers to study.

NASA's Human Moon Lander Program Finally Gets Full Funding in New Budget Bill (theverge.com) 55

If Congress' sweeping new spending bill is signed, it would finally provide full funding to some major NASA projects that have been underfunded over the last few years. From a report: Notably, NASA's program to develop a new human lunar lander would be fully funded as the president's budget requested, as will a program to develop new commercial space stations in low Earth orbit. Overall, NASA would receive $24.041 billion for 2022 in this new bill, which will fund the US government for fiscal year 2022. NASA's portion is roughly $800 million less than the $24.8 billion that President Joe Biden's budget request called for in May of 2021. However, NASA would still see a slight bump from its total funding for fiscal year 2021, which sat at $23.27 billion.

Though Congress's plan would not fully meet the president's budget request, there are a few projects that House and Senate lawmakers are finally agreeing to fund in their entirety. The bill would give NASA's human landing system the full $1.195 billion that the request asked for. Currently, NASA is developing a new human lunar lander as part of its Artemis program, an initiative to send the first woman and first person of color to the Moon. Previously, Congress showed its reluctance to give NASA the money it requested for the lander. For 2021, appropriators only provided $850 million of the requested $3.4 billion for the lander.

Two Giant Black Holes Colliding Sent Ripples Through Space (usatoday.com) 24

"In a galaxy far, far away, two giant black holes appear to be circling each other like fighters in a galactic boxing ring," reports USA Today.

"Gravity is causing this death spiral, which will result in a collision and formation of a single black hole, a massive event that will send ripples through space and time." The collision itself happened eons ago — the two black holes are located about 9 billion light years from Earth. Scientists won't be able to document it for 10,000 years. Even so, there are imperceptible gravitational waves generated before the collision that are hitting us right now. These waves from the black holes' activity will increase, but will not affect Earth. However, they could help increase our understanding of how our universe has evolved.

Such supermassive black holes "are the most powerful and energetic objects in the universe and they have an enormous effect on the evolution of galaxies and stars," Tony Readhead, an astronomy professor at the California Institute of Technology, told USA TODAY. He is the co-author of the report by Caltech astronomers who detail the discovery in The Astrophysical Journal Letters, a peer-reviewed scientific journal. "If we want to understand the evolution of our universe we need to understand these objects," Readhead said....

Each of the black holes identified in this study has a mass amounting to hundreds of millions of times more than that of our sun, the researchers say. It took about 100 million years for the two objects to converge on their orbit, which has them at a distance of about 50 times that separating our sun and Pluto, NASA said. The two black holes are more than 99% of the way toward colliding, the agency said....

This is only the second pair of orbiting black holes identified by scientists, the researchers say. Space-time undulations from gravitational waves made by two colliding black holes 1.3 billion light-years away were recorded in 2015 by the National Science Foundation's Laser Interferometer Gravitational-Wave Observatory.

The US Space Force Plans To Start Patrolling the Area Around the Moon (arstechnica.com) 68

An anonymous reader quotes a report from Ars Technica: This week, the US Air Force Research Laboratory released a video on YouTube that didn't get much attention. But it made an announcement that is fairly significant -- the US military plans to extend its space awareness capabilities beyond geostationary orbit, all the way to the Moon. "Until now, the United States space mission extended 22,000 miles above Earth," a narrator says in the video. "That was then, this is now. The Air Force Research Laboratory is extending that range by 10 times and the operations area of the United States by 1,000 times, taking our reach to the far side of the Moon into cislunar space."

The US military had previously talked about extending its operational domain, but now it is taking action. It plans to launch a satellite, likely equipped with a powerful telescope, into cislunar space. According to the video, the satellite will be called the Cislunar Highway Patrol System or, you guessed it, CHPS. The research laboratory plans to issue a "request for prototype proposals" for the CHPS satellite on March 21 and announce the contract award in July. The CHPS program will be managed by Michael Lopez, from the lab's Space Vehicles Directorate. (Alas, we were rooting for Erik Estrada).

This effort will include the participation of several military organizations, and it can be a little confusing to keep track of. Essentially, though, the Air Force lab will oversee the development of the satellite. The US Space Force will then procure this capability for use by the US Space Command, which is responsible for military operations in outer space. Effectively, this satellite is the beginning of an extension of operations by US Space Command from geostationary space to beyond the Moon. [...] So why is US Space Command interested in expanding its theater of operations to include the Moon? The primary reason cited in the video is managing increasing space traffic in the lunar environment, including several NASA-sponsored commercial missions, the space agency's Artemis program, and those of other nations.
Another strategic element includes the ability to detect space objects, such as those placed into cislunar space by other governments, that could swing around the Moon and potentially come back to attack a U.S. military satellite in geostationary space.

"I think that's far fetched, but it is feasible from a physics perspective and would definitely exploit a gap in their current space domain awareness," said Brian Weeden, director of program planning for the Secure World Foundation. "I think they are far more concerned about that than any actual threats in cislunar space because the US doesn't have any military assets in cislunar space right now."

NASA Rover Spots Unreal Mars 'Flower' Formation (cnet.com) 13

Thelasko shares a report from CNET: NASA's Curiosity rover snapped a gorgeous, delicate formation on Mars that looks like it could be a branching piece of ocean coral. It's not coral, but it's worth contemplating how we see familiar Earth objects in random shapes on Mars. The miniscule Martian sculpture invites poetic comparisons. It resembles a water droplet captured at the moment of explosion against a surface, or the tendrils of an anemone in a tide pool.

The image comes from Curiosity's Mars Hand Lens Imager (Mahli) instrument, which NASA describes as "the rover's version of the magnifying hand lens that geologists usually carry with them into the field." So the formation in the image is quite small. Abigail Fraeman, a deputy project scientist for Curiosity, tweeted a helpful visual guide that compares the object with a US penny to give an approximate sense of the scale. Fraeman writes that the image "shows teeny, tiny delicate structures that formed by mineral precipitating from water."

NASA Assures ISS Will Continue Orbiting Despite Sanctions on Russia (msn.com) 78

On Thursday the head of Russia's space agency "warned that new sanctions imposed on his country could have dire consequences for the International Space Station program," reports Space.com (in an article shared by Slashdot reader Hmmmmmm): "Do you want to destroy our cooperation on the ISS?" read one of the tweets from Roscosmos Director-General Dimitry Rogozin, which was translated by Rob Mitchell for Ars Technica senior space editor Eric Berger, who shared Mitchell's translation on Twitter. Russia and the United States are the major partners in the ISS program, which also includes Canada, Japan and multiple European nations...

NASA, however, told Space.com later Thursday that civil cooperation between the U.S. and Russia in space will continue, particularly with regard to the ISS.

But Rogozin struck a much different tone, suggesting that the new sanctions could potentially result in the ISS crashing to Earth in an uncontrolled fashion. (The Russian segment of the ISS is responsible for guidance, navigation and control for the entire complex, according to the European Space Agency. And Russian Progress cargo craft provide periodic orbit-raising boosts for the ISS, to ensure that it doesn't sink too low into Earth's atmosphere....) Rogozin also stressed that the ISS would deorbit naturally without periodic reboosts courtesy of Progress freighters....

Just days ago, however, a Cygnus spacecraft built by aerospace company Northrop Grumman arrived at the ISS with a mandate to perform the program's first operational reboost, which may eventually transfer this capability to U.S. vehicles as well.

Business Insider reports that Thursday's tweets from the head of Russia's space agency also included a dire hypothetical. "If you block cooperation with us, who will save the ISS from an uncontrolled deorbit and fall into the United States or Europe?"

On Saturday Elon Musk "responded by posting the logo of his company, SpaceX." Musk appeared to confirm that SpaceX would get involved, should the ISS fall out of orbit. A Twitter user asked if that's what the tech mogul really meant, to which Musk simply replied: "Yes."

NASA, meanwhile, said it "continues working with Roscosmos and our other international partners in Canada, Europe, and Japan to maintain safe and continuous ISS operations," in a statement to Euronews.
